WHO says COVID originated in bats, but critics claim bias
The PBS NewsHour has obtained a study by a group of independent researchers convened by the WHO to find the origins of COVID-19 in China. As Nick Schifrin reports, the virus that caused the worst pandemic in a century most likely started in bats, and jumped to humans through an intermediate animal host. The researchers call it a starting point, but their critics still say it doesn’t go far enough.
